Summary: | A disclosed set top box or other type of multimedia handling device (MHD) is configured to support a toggle volume feature that enables the end user to toggle between two or more substantially different audible volume settings using a single push of a single remote control button or other type of control, e.g., a touch screen control. In some embodiments, the MHD includes a processor, storage media accessible to and readable by the processor, a remote control interface in communication with the processor, a multimedia decoder, and an audio digital-to-analog converter. The remote control interface receives input from a remote control device. The multimedia decoder module receives and processes multimedia streams. The decoder generates a decoder audio output and a decoder video output. The DAC processes the decoder audio output and produces an audio signal having a particular volume level. |
